How to repair double eyelid surgery?

How to repair double eyelid surgery?

Many people have double eyelid surgery for the sake of beauty. During the double eyelid cutting process, you need to pay attention to the importance of the surgery and the recovery method of the surgery. Generally, double eyelid cutting surgery can be recovered within a week, but it takes two months for the swelling to slowly subside and for the local tissue to heal. However, after the operation, many people have narrow or uneven double eyelids due to surgical failure, which will look very embarrassing and require full double eyelid cutting and repair to achieve the treatment effect.

Patients who are not satisfied with the results of double eyelid surgery should have it repaired immediately within 1 week after the surgery.

If it exceeds 1 week and the sutures have been removed, the 2 months after the operation is the tissue healing period. The tissue fragility increases and scar hyperplasia is likely to occur if surgery is performed at this time. Therefore, it is best to consider double eyelid repair surgery 1 week after surgery or 6 months after the initial surgery.

Double eyelid revision surgery is necessary in the following situations:

1. Those with double eyelids that are too wide or too low. After double eyelid surgery, the double eyelids may appear too wide or too low. This is because of improper or inaccurate design. The operation was not performed according to the designed line, resulting in the incision being too wide or too narrow. Redesign the incision and then perform double eyelid plastic surgery.

2. Multi-layer double eyelids. Too much orbicularis oculi muscle was removed above the incision, causing the upper eyelid skin to adhere to the deep tissue and form multi-layer double eyelids. After the formed tissue is decomposed and the original double eyelid is removed, a new double eyelid line is created.

3. The two eyes are asymmetrical. The two eyes are asymmetrical, resulting in one eye being different in size. This is due to improper design or the doctor's inaccurate operation during surgery, which does not follow the designed line. You can modify it according to the one you are satisfied with.

4. Double eyelid scars appear. Uneven and poorly aligned incision edges, incision infection or improper care can lead to scar hyperplasia. In this case, the formed tissue can be decomposed and the original double eyelids can be removed, and then a new double eyelid line can be created.
